Trump Organization Eyes New Tower in Vietnam, Local Authorities say

Trump Organization Eyes New Tower in Vietnam. (Photo: Jon Tyson on Unsplash)

AFP – United States President Donald Trump’s real estate company is seeking to build a tower in Ho Chi Minh City, Vietnamese officials said on Tuesday, with his son due to scout locations this week.

Authorities in Vietnam’s southern business hub said in a statement that they met with a representative of the Trump Organization and its local partner, the Kinh Bac City Development Corporation (KBC).

The statement said authorities had already conducted a field survey of two potential locations in the eastern part of the city on Monday and are scheduled to meet leaders of the Trump Organization on Thursday.

The company, which builds luxury developments around the world, has come under scrutiny, with critics accusing Trump of leveraging his political position for personal financial gain.

The state-controlled Tuoi Tre newspaper said the organisation’s senior vice-president, Eric Trump, the US president’s second son, would lead the visit.

It also said the delegation would visit a proposed location for “Trump Tower”.

The Trump Organization did not respond immediately to AFP’s request for comment.

Tuoi Tre said Eric Trump would also attend a ground-breaking ceremony on Wednesday for a USD 1.5 billion luxury resort and golf course developed by the Trump Organization and KBC.

The 990-hectare golf complex in northern Hung Yen province outside Hanoi will feature a 54-hole course and residential villas, the newspaper said.

Project director Charles Boyd-Bowman said in a meeting with Vietnam’s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h in March that his group aimed to finish the golf resort in March 2027, before Vietnam hosts the Asia-Pacific Economic Cooperation (APEC) summit.

Vietnam and the United States are engaged in trade talks after President Trump threatened a 46 percent levy on Vietnamese goods as part of his global tariff blitz.

Trump visited the Vietnamese capital in 2019 for his abortive second summit with North Korean leader Kim Jong Un.

He described Hanoi at the time as an “incredible city” and praised Vietnam for “the job they’ve done, economic development.”

Turning U.S. Tax Hurdles into Opportunities for Chinese Brands with Affiliate Marketing

DUBAI, UAE, May 21, 2025 /PRNewswire/ — Recent U.S. tax policy changes present significant challenges for Chinese brands in the American market, demanding strategic adaptation for sustainable growth. The end of the De Minimis Exemption means that shipments under $800 from China are no longer duty-free. Coupled with massive tariff hikes of up to 54% on imports and a 10% universal baseline tariff affecting Chinese goods, these shifts threaten profit margins and market competitiveness.

This evolving tax landscape has heightened administrative demands and financial strains, challenging profitability and competitiveness. Products like fast fashion or gadgets, once cheap and competitive, now face increased costs. For instance, a $5 T-shirt could now incur $1.50 in duties, squeezing profit margins and raising retail prices.

To navigate these challenges, Chinese brands are embracing agility and innovation. Brands like SHEIN are diversifying into booming markets such as India and the Middle East, leveraging local partnerships to sidestep tariffs. Hybrid pricing strategies, where part of the tariff cost is absorbed initially to offset expenses, are proving effective. 1 in 4 Malaysians at Risk: Alpro Pharmacy Leads National Movement to Reverse Prediabetes


KUALA LUMPUR, MALAYSIA – Media OutReach Newswire – 21 May 2025 – With one in four Malaysian adults unknowingly living with prediabetes, the country is facing a silent but escalating health crisis. Research shows that one in ten individuals with prediabetes will develop type 2 diabetes within a year, and up to 70% will progress within a decade if no action is taken (Sources: National Health and Morbidity Survey 2019; International Diabetes Federation).
